Phlebotomy Training and Their Requirements

It’s vital to meet all of the requirements for becoming a Phlebotomy Technician prior to beginning your training. The candidate has to be the legal age, have earned a high school diploma or equivalent, successfully pass a background check, and must take a drug test.

Is it Mandatory That I Get My Certification?

The National Association of Phlebotomy Professionals oversees the certification and regulation for Phlebotomy Technicians. The American Society of Phlebotomy Technicians also advises that a certified or licensed Phlebotomist needs to be listed on the national registry. After becoming certified and listed, one might expect to see increased pay and a higher probability of work.
